An epidural blood patch is a treatment for a post dural puncture headache. This is a specific type of headache caused by an epidural or spinal procedure. Having a blood patch is similar to having an epidural procedure. It is carried out in our operating theatre. On this occasion we will take your own blood from ...

WebBlood patch: The concept of the epidural blood patch was developed after the observation made on patients who had “bloody tap”, in whom the incidence of headache was low. Once blood is introduced into the epidural space, it will form a clot and seal the perforation, thus preventing further leak of CSF.
WebEpidural Blood Patch Incidence of Spinal Headache. The chances of having a spinal headache depend on many factors including age, weight and size of needle used for the procedure. A spinal headache may occur up to 5 days after the lumbar puncture.
